Riverside House

London, United Kingdom

Riverside House is a standalone mixed-use office building bounded by the Thames Path, Southwark Bridge Road, and Bear Gardens Conservation Area. Boasting a prime river location within close proximity to the Tate Modern, Shakespeare’s Globe, and many of London’s busiest transport hubs, Riverside House offers excellent views across the Thames to St. Paul’s, The London Eye, and Westminster.

Repositioning the existing building required careful consideration of the site’s contextual constraints and complexities to ensure longstanding improvements for current and future users. Working closely with the client to strategically address the building’s existing issues, Gensler proposed a unique design response to create an amenity-rich environment that supports an integrated work/life experience, which in turn, attracts top talent for anchor tenants without having to build anew.
